Key Insights
The global market for small-sized lithium-ion secondary batteries is poised for substantial expansion, projected to reach an estimated USD 16.04 billion in 2025. This growth is propelled by a robust Compound Annual Growth Rate (CAGR) of 10.3% throughout the forecast period of 2025-2033. This strong upward trajectory is primarily driven by the relentless demand from the consumer electronics sector, which continues to innovate with smaller, more powerful devices. Furthermore, the burgeoning electric vehicle (EV) and e-bike industries are significant contributors, requiring lightweight and high-density energy storage solutions. The increasing adoption of portable power solutions, such as power banks, also fuels this market's expansion. Emerging applications within specialized tools and other niche segments are expected to further diversify and strengthen demand.

The market dynamics are characterized by distinct trends and certain restraints that shape its trajectory. Key trends include advancements in battery chemistry leading to higher energy density and faster charging capabilities, along with a growing emphasis on battery safety and lifespan. The proliferation of smart devices and the Internet of Things (IoT) further necessitates compact and reliable power sources. However, challenges such as raw material price volatility, particularly for lithium and cobalt, and the need for sophisticated recycling infrastructure pose as significant restraints. Intense competition among leading players like Panasonic, Samsung SDI, LG Chem, and BYD, coupled with ongoing research and development efforts for next-generation battery technologies, will define the competitive landscape. The Asia Pacific region, particularly China, is expected to dominate both production and consumption due to its strong manufacturing base and rapidly growing end-user industries.
